Original Description
Giovanni Grubacs’ Venice, A View Of The Molo Looking East; Venice, A View Of The Entrance To The Grand Canal At Sunset captures the enchanting allure of 19th-century Venice with remarkable atmospheric precision. This paired composition exemplifies the Romantic tradition of Venetian vedute, blending topographical accuracy with poetic luminosity. Grubacs, active during Venice’s waning grandeur under Austrian rule, imbues the scenes with nostalgic golden light—the eastern Molo basks in morning clarity while the Grand Canal simmers with crepuscular warmth. His loose yet controlled brushwork reveals influences from Guardi’s spontaneity and Canaletto’s architectural rigor, positioning these works as important successors to the 18th-century view-painting legacy. The juxtaposition of bustling dock activity against serene water reflections creates a dynamic equilibrium, making this diptych particularly representative of Venice’s dual identity as a mercantile powerhouse and aesthetic paradise.
